1. Establish Your Goals
You must first comprehend why you are using the platform in the first place before you can begin the Salesforce implementation procedure. To put it another way, you must specify what you hope to accomplish using the Salesforce platform, the issues you wish to resolve, and the practical applications of the technology.
More importantly, ensure your goals are attainable, measurable, and precise. You should break your project into smaller plans for the greatest outcomes to make an implementation roadmap that will make it simple to track your results.

3. Determine Who Will Utilize Your Salesforce Platform
The identity of your salesforce platform’s end users must be established. This could be a marketing, sales, business, services, IT, or finance team.
The needs of each department could be different, even if you might need to install the Salesforce platform for more than one department. The good news is that by identifying whom Salesforce is intended for, you can adapt the platform to meet the needs of its target audience. By doing this, features that a team does not require are avoided.

7. Create measurable performance indicators for your objectives
You must assess whether the Salesforce Implementation Partners in India are assisting you in achieving your planned goals when the implementation is finished and operational. Simply put, you must establish quantifiable performance indicators to determine your platform’s effectiveness.
Your base performance statistic should be the customer churn rate if, for example, one of your objectives is to reduce it by 30%. In this manner, it will be simpler to determine whether the platform is assisting you in achieving your goals.
